Why Google AI Overviews Wins the AI Search Race on Reach

The decisive number is distribution. Google processes the bulk of the world's roughly 5 trillion annual searches, and AI Overviews now appear on a large share of those queries by default. No download, no new habit, no second tab — the AI answer is simply there. That's how Google put generative answers in front of ~2 billion people without winning a single new user.

Google AI Overviews

~2B monthly reach. Wired into Search, Chrome, and Android. Defends an estimated 85%+ share of global search and keeps AI traffic in-house rather than ceding it.

ChatGPT Search

800M+ weekly ChatGPT users, a subset of whom search. Launched search inside the app so users never leave the conversation — habit, not distribution, is the moat.

Perplexity

~22M monthly actives, up from a few million in 2023. Under 1% of search volume but the highest satisfaction for research and the cleanest source citations.

The hard truth for challengers: search is a distribution game first and a quality game second. Perplexity can build the better answer engine and still touch 1% of the users Google reaches by default. Accuracy and Citations: Where Perplexity Beats Both

Reach isn't the same as trust. On the metric that matters for serious queries — can I verify this answer? — Perplexity leads. It was built as an answer engine, so every claim carries an inline numbered citation, and follow-up questions chain naturally. ChatGPT Search cites sources but buries them; Google AI Overviews summarize, then push the blue links below, which has drawn the most accuracy complaints of the three.

The pattern is consistent: the more your query rewards verification, the more Perplexity pulls ahead. Google's AI Overviews famously shipped some embarrassing wrong answers in 2024, and while accuracy improved through 2025–2026, the snippet-first format still trains users to trust a summary they can't easily check. For a research workflow, that's the opposite of what you want.

The Business Models Behind AI Search in 2026

Each product is funded differently, and that shapes who can survive a price war. Google AI Overviews are free because ads pay for them — but generative answers cannibalize the very clicks that fund Google, which is the existential tension inside Alphabet's ~$2.1T machine. Perplexity sells $20/month Pro subscriptions plus an enterprise tier. ChatGPT Search rides OpenAI's broader subscription and API revenue, estimated near $13B annualized.

Google AI Overviews

Ads-funded and free, but every AI answer that satisfies a user is a search-ad click that didn't happen. Google must protect ~$200B+ of search-ad revenue while giving away the answer.

Perplexity ($18B)

Subscription-first at ~$20/month Pro plus enterprise seats. Cleaner incentives — it's paid to be accurate, not to maximize clicks — but it must fund frontier model costs on far less revenue.

ChatGPT Search

Bundled into OpenAI's ~$13B annualized revenue across ChatGPT Plus, enterprise, and API. Search is a feature that deepens the ChatGPT habit rather than a standalone P&L.

The squeeze

Inference costs are falling, so answer quality commoditizes. The winner is whoever pairs good-enough answers with the cheapest distribution — which still favors Google.

Perplexity's ~$18B valuation is a bet that a clean, subscription-funded answer engine carves out a durable premium niche — the way Bloomberg did against free financial data. That's plausible.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best AI search engine in 2026?

It depends on the job. Google AI Overviews reaches the most people — roughly 2 billion monthly users — and is best for everyday queries you already do on Google. Perplexity, near 22M monthly actives, is the best for research because it cites sources cleanly and lets you follow up. ChatGPT Search, riding 800M+ weekly ChatGPT users, is best when your search starts inside a longer conversation.

Is Perplexity better than ChatGPT for search?

For pure search and research, Perplexity is generally better than ChatGPT. It was built as an answer engine, so it shows numbered citations inline, defaults to fresh web results, and makes follow-up questions natural. ChatGPT Search is improving fast and has the advantage of 800M+ weekly users already in the app, but its citations are less prominent and its answers can drift from the live web.

How many people use Google AI Overviews in 2026?

Google's AI Overviews reach roughly 2 billion users monthly in 2026, because they appear automatically at the top of Google Search results for a large share of queries. Users don't opt in — that distribution advantage is why Google leads the AI search race on reach even though Perplexity and ChatGPT often produce more focused answers.

What is Perplexity's valuation in 2026?

Perplexity is valued at roughly $18B in 2026, up from about $9B in 2024 and $520M in early 2024. The company reportedly reached the low hundreds of millions in annualized revenue from its Pro subscriptions (~$20/month) and enterprise tier, but it still holds under 1% of global search volume against Google's dominant share.

Will AI search replace Google in 2026?

Not in 2026. Google still handles the overwhelming majority of the world's roughly 5 trillion annual searches, and AI Overviews kept most of that traffic inside Google rather than losing it to Perplexity or ChatGPT. AI search is taking share at the margin — especially for research-heavy queries — but Google's distribution through Chrome, Android, and default placement remains the deciding factor.
